CAUTION
Caution regarding interference with electronic devices
People with implantable cardiac pacemakers, cardiac resynchronization
therapy-pacemakers or implantable cardioverter defibrillators should
maintain a reasonable distance between themselves and the smart entry &
start system antennas. (P. 125)
The radio waves may affect the operation of such devices. If necessary,
the entry function can be disabled. Ask any authorized Lexus dealer or
repairer, or another duly qualified and equipped professional for details,
such as the frequency of radio waves and timing of the emitted radio
waves. Then, consult your doctor to see if you should disable the entry
function.
Users of any electrical medical device other than implantable cardiac
pacemakers, cardiac resynchronization therapy-pacemakers or implant-
able cardioverter defibrillators should consult the manufacturer of the
device for information about its operation under the influence of radio
waves.
Radio waves could have unexpected effects on the operation of such med-
ical devices.
Ask any authorized Lexus dealer or repairer, or another duly qualified and
equipped professional for details on disabling the entry function.
NOTICE
When opening the trunk
Do not press the rear view monitor sys-
tem camera by mistake.
If the camera or surrounding area
receives a strong impact, the camera may
move off its installed position and/or
angle.
